| Arterolane Usage And Synthesis |
Definition | ChEBI: Arterolane is an oxaspiro compound that is dispiro[cyclohexane-1,3'-[1,2,4]trioxolane-5',2''-tricyclo[3.3.1.1(3,7)]decane] substituted by a 2-[(2-amino-2-methylpropyl)amino]-2-oxoethyl group at position 4s. Its maleic acid salt is used as an antimalarial drug in combination with piperaquine. It has a role as an antimalarial and an antiplasmodial drug. It is a member of adamantanes, a secondary carboxamide, a primary amino compound, a trioxolane and an oxaspiro compound. It is a conjugate base of an arterolane(1+). |
